• 
    

    
    

      99热精品在线国产_美女午夜性视频免费_国产精品国产高清国产av_av欧美777_自拍偷自拍亚洲精品老妇_亚洲熟女精品中文字幕_www日本黄色视频网_国产精品野战在线观看

      ?

      高中代數(shù)思想在“密鑰共享”中的應(yīng)用

      2013-10-24 08:53:52趙世棋林昌露
      中國校外教育 2013年31期
      關(guān)鍵詞:方程組代數(shù)數(shù)形

      ◆趙世棋 林昌露

      (福建南安市柳城中學(xué);福建師范大學(xué)數(shù)學(xué)與計算機科學(xué)學(xué)院)

      華羅庚先生說過:“數(shù)缺形時少直觀,形少數(shù)時難入微;數(shù)形結(jié)合百般好,隔裂分家萬事休。”數(shù)和形是數(shù)學(xué)學(xué)習(xí)和研究的兩個重要內(nèi)容。在高中數(shù)學(xué)學(xué)習(xí)中,“數(shù)形結(jié)合”不僅是一個重要的代數(shù)數(shù)學(xué)思想,又是一種常用的數(shù)學(xué)解題方法?!靶畔踩c密碼”是《普通高中數(shù)學(xué)課程標(biāo)準(zhǔn)(實驗)》中選修系列3的六個專題之一。在當(dāng)今信息化的社會當(dāng)中,人們每天在互聯(lián)網(wǎng)和物聯(lián)網(wǎng)上傳輸、獲取、交換海量的信息,這也帶來更多的信息安全問題。在高中階段對信息安全與密碼知識的學(xué)習(xí),不僅有助于培養(yǎng)和增強學(xué)生的信息安全意識,而且有助于培養(yǎng)學(xué)生應(yīng)用數(shù)學(xué)的能力和學(xué)習(xí)數(shù)學(xué)的興趣。本文將從密碼學(xué)中的“密鑰共享”與高中數(shù)學(xué)中的“數(shù)形結(jié)合”的代數(shù)思想入手,分析數(shù)學(xué)在信息安全與密碼中的重要作用。

      一、問題的提出

      密鑰共享的基本思想,可以通過如下例子來表述:某個銀行的保險庫,每天至少需要用密碼(即密鑰)打開一次;銀行雇傭四位出納,但是銀行為提高保險庫的安全性并不想將密鑰委托給單個出納。這時,銀行可以利用密鑰共享的方法來設(shè)計一個安全的系統(tǒng)保護這個密鑰。在該系統(tǒng)中,銀行把密鑰分成四部分并獨立分發(fā)給四位出納;該系統(tǒng)保證任意三位或四位出納同時在場才可用密鑰打開保險庫,而任意單獨或兩位的出納不能打開保險庫。此外,即使有一位出納的那份密鑰意外地丟失,其他三位出納仍然可正?;謴?fù)整個密鑰。對于上述的問題和要求,如何用一個數(shù)學(xué)的方法來有效地解決呢?

      二、問題的求解

      解法一:解方程組方法

      1979年,著名密碼學(xué)家阿迪·沙米爾利用解方程組的方法給出了一個簡單且有效的方法。我們用一個簡單的例子展示該方法:在數(shù)字化世界中,可假設(shè)密鑰是一個數(shù)字,這是發(fā)揮數(shù)學(xué)作用的第一步。具體地,設(shè)密鑰為2,四位出納分別用1、2、3和4表示,選取一個二次多項式f(x)=2+3x+x2,它滿足f(0)=2,即當(dāng)x取零時,由這個多項式計算的結(jié)果恰好是密鑰值2;計算f(1)=6,f(2)=12,f(3)=20和f(4)=30,并把這四個值分別秘密地分發(fā)給四位出納。這樣,我們已經(jīng)完成這個保護系統(tǒng)的設(shè)置,該密鑰的部分密鑰分別由四位出納安全地保管。假設(shè)前三位出納同時在場,此時只需把由他們保管的秘密值6、12、20拿出來,大家就可以用解方程組的方法簡單地恢復(fù)得到密鑰值,計算過程如下:假設(shè)該二次方程是f(x)=a+bx+cx2,則可得到如下方程組:通過求解該方程組,可得a=2,即f(0)=a=2為密鑰值。若只有一位或兩位出納同時在場,由解方程組的方法可知,則他們只能得到有一個方程或兩個方程的方程組,但有三個未知數(shù),故該秘密值無法正確地被恢復(fù)。

      解法二:幾何方法

      現(xiàn)在,從幾何角度來更直觀地分析一下上述方法。我們先把出納的代表值和各自的部分秘密值分別看成直角坐標(biāo)系中的坐標(biāo)點,即(1,6)、(2,12)、(3,20)和(4,30),且把密鑰也看一個坐標(biāo)點(0,2)??砂讯味囗検娇闯梢粭l二次曲線,密鑰值是該曲線與縱軸的交點,每位出納的部分秘密值均是曲線上某個點的縱坐標(biāo)值(見圖1)。由二次曲線的性質(zhì)可知,若已知曲線上的三個坐標(biāo)點,可容易在直角坐標(biāo)系上畫出完整的曲線,即可以獲得與縱軸的交點值;若僅知道曲線上一個或兩個坐標(biāo)點(如A和B,見圖2),那么該曲線與縱軸的交點可能有無數(shù)個(如:C1,C2,…,Cn),即無法確定該密鑰值。

      綜上所述,我們分別從代數(shù)的觀點和幾何的觀點,分析了密鑰共享的基本思想,充分展現(xiàn)了高中代數(shù)學(xué)習(xí)中“數(shù)形結(jié)合”的思想方法。從這兩個角度看問題,不僅可以讓學(xué)生直觀體驗到數(shù)形結(jié)合的思想方法,提高學(xué)生對數(shù)學(xué)的鑒賞力和學(xué)習(xí)數(shù)學(xué)的興趣,而且可以幫助學(xué)生對密鑰共享方法的理解,提高他們對“信息安全和密碼”學(xué)習(xí)的興趣,有利于學(xué)生進一步發(fā)展,對實現(xiàn)“信息安全與密碼”模塊教學(xué)也起到探索的作用。

      [1]袁智強.《信息安全與密碼》教學(xué)構(gòu)思及評價設(shè)想.數(shù)學(xué)通訊,2005,(11):9-10.

      [2]劉木蘭,張志芳.密鑰共享體制和安全多方計算.北京:電子工業(yè)出版社,2008.

      猜你喜歡
      方程組代數(shù)數(shù)形
      深入學(xué)習(xí)“二元一次方程組”
      數(shù)形結(jié)合 理解坐標(biāo)
      數(shù)形結(jié)合 相得益彰
      數(shù)形結(jié)合百般好
      兩個有趣的無窮長代數(shù)不等式鏈
      Hopf代數(shù)的二重Ore擴張
      數(shù)形結(jié)合 直觀明了
      《二元一次方程組》鞏固練習(xí)
      什么是代數(shù)幾何
      科學(xué)(2020年1期)2020-08-24 08:08:06
      一類次臨界Bose-Einstein凝聚型方程組的漸近收斂行為和相位分離
      衡阳市| 福海县| 娱乐| 高密市| 嘉祥县| 海淀区| 镇雄县| 信阳市| 保德县| 比如县| 青河县| 克拉玛依市| 台北市| 通许县| 垫江县| 长治县| 曲阜市| 景德镇市| 苗栗县| 池州市| 乐至县| 旅游| 清徐县| 桐乡市| 东安县| 纳雍县| 台东市| 满城县| 新巴尔虎右旗| 平顶山市| 定安县| 兴业县| 汕头市| 瓮安县| 南江县| 靖宇县| 灵丘县| 周口市| 永修县| 柘城县| 江川县|